2018-12-23 22:28:57 +01:00
|
|
|
<!DOCTYPE html>
|
|
|
|
<html lang="en">
|
|
|
|
<head>
|
|
|
|
<meta charset="utf-8">
|
2019-12-05 21:25:36 +01:00
|
|
|
<link rel="shortcut icon" href="favicon.ico">
|
2024-12-28 11:57:13 +02:00
|
|
|
<meta name="apple-mobile-web-app-capable" content="yes">
|
|
|
|
<meta name="apple-mobile-web-app-status-bar-style" content="black-translucent" />
|
2025-01-02 01:36:58 +02:00
|
|
|
<meta name="viewport" content="width=device-width, initial-scale=1, maximum-scale=1, viewport-fit=cover" />
|
2021-01-27 20:58:20 +01:00
|
|
|
<meta name="theme-color" content="#fff">
|
2024-07-14 21:20:42 +03:00
|
|
|
<title>TriliumNext Notes</title>
|
2024-02-14 07:21:31 +01:00
|
|
|
<link rel="manifest" crossorigin="use-credentials" href="manifest.webmanifest">
|
2020-04-11 22:06:04 +02:00
|
|
|
|
|
|
|
<style>
|
|
|
|
.lds-roller {
|
|
|
|
display: inline-block;
|
|
|
|
position: relative;
|
|
|
|
width: 80px;
|
|
|
|
height: 80px;
|
|
|
|
}
|
|
|
|
.lds-roller div {
|
|
|
|
animation: lds-roller 1.2s cubic-bezier(0.5, 0, 0.5, 1) infinite;
|
|
|
|
transform-origin: 40px 40px;
|
|
|
|
}
|
|
|
|
.lds-roller div:after {
|
|
|
|
content: " ";
|
|
|
|
display: block;
|
|
|
|
position: absolute;
|
|
|
|
width: 7px;
|
|
|
|
height: 7px;
|
|
|
|
border-radius: 50%;
|
|
|
|
background: #000;
|
|
|
|
margin: -4px 0 0 -4px;
|
|
|
|
}
|
|
|
|
.lds-roller div:nth-child(1) {
|
|
|
|
animation-delay: -0.036s;
|
|
|
|
}
|
|
|
|
.lds-roller div:nth-child(1):after {
|
|
|
|
top: 63px;
|
|
|
|
left: 63px;
|
|
|
|
}
|
|
|
|
.lds-roller div:nth-child(2) {
|
|
|
|
animation-delay: -0.072s;
|
|
|
|
}
|
|
|
|
.lds-roller div:nth-child(2):after {
|
|
|
|
top: 68px;
|
|
|
|
left: 56px;
|
|
|
|
}
|
|
|
|
.lds-roller div:nth-child(3) {
|
|
|
|
animation-delay: -0.108s;
|
|
|
|
}
|
|
|
|
.lds-roller div:nth-child(3):after {
|
|
|
|
top: 71px;
|
|
|
|
left: 48px;
|
|
|
|
}
|
|
|
|
.lds-roller div:nth-child(4) {
|
|
|
|
animation-delay: -0.144s;
|
|
|
|
}
|
|
|
|
.lds-roller div:nth-child(4):after {
|
|
|
|
top: 72px;
|
|
|
|
left: 40px;
|
|
|
|
}
|
|
|
|
.lds-roller div:nth-child(5) {
|
|
|
|
animation-delay: -0.18s;
|
|
|
|
}
|
|
|
|
.lds-roller div:nth-child(5):after {
|
|
|
|
top: 71px;
|
|
|
|
left: 32px;
|
|
|
|
}
|
|
|
|
.lds-roller div:nth-child(6) {
|
|
|
|
animation-delay: -0.216s;
|
|
|
|
}
|
|
|
|
.lds-roller div:nth-child(6):after {
|
|
|
|
top: 68px;
|
|
|
|
left: 24px;
|
|
|
|
}
|
|
|
|
.lds-roller div:nth-child(7) {
|
|
|
|
animation-delay: -0.252s;
|
|
|
|
}
|
|
|
|
.lds-roller div:nth-child(7):after {
|
|
|
|
top: 63px;
|
|
|
|
left: 17px;
|
|
|
|
}
|
|
|
|
.lds-roller div:nth-child(8) {
|
|
|
|
animation-delay: -0.288s;
|
|
|
|
}
|
|
|
|
.lds-roller div:nth-child(8):after {
|
|
|
|
top: 56px;
|
|
|
|
left: 12px;
|
|
|
|
}
|
|
|
|
@keyframes lds-roller {
|
|
|
|
0% {
|
|
|
|
transform: rotate(0deg);
|
|
|
|
}
|
|
|
|
100% {
|
|
|
|
transform: rotate(360deg);
|
|
|
|
}
|
|
|
|
}
|
|
|
|
</style>
|
2018-12-23 22:28:57 +01:00
|
|
|
</head>
|
2021-10-11 23:00:52 +02:00
|
|
|
<body class="mobile heading-style-<%= headingStyle %>">
|
2024-09-08 18:55:11 +03:00
|
|
|
<noscript><%= t("javascript-required") %></noscript>
|
2019-10-17 20:44:51 +02:00
|
|
|
|
|
|
|
<div id="toast-container" class="d-flex flex-column justify-content-center align-items-center"></div>
|
|
|
|
|
2024-12-28 10:22:01 +02:00
|
|
|
<div id="context-menu-cover"></div>
|
|
|
|
|
2020-03-01 12:50:02 +01:00
|
|
|
<div class="dropdown-menu dropdown-menu-sm" id="context-menu-container"></div>
|
2018-12-23 22:28:57 +01:00
|
|
|
|
|
|
|
<script type="text/javascript">
|
2021-12-24 22:18:05 +01:00
|
|
|
global = globalThis; /* fixes https://github.com/webpack/webpack/issues/10035 */
|
|
|
|
|
2018-12-23 22:28:57 +01:00
|
|
|
window.glob = {
|
2023-05-03 22:49:24 +02:00
|
|
|
device: "mobile",
|
|
|
|
baseApiUrl: 'api/',
|
2018-12-23 22:28:57 +01:00
|
|
|
activeDialog: null,
|
2020-08-02 23:27:48 +02:00
|
|
|
maxEntityChangeIdAtLoad: <%= maxEntityChangeIdAtLoad %>,
|
2021-03-21 22:43:41 +01:00
|
|
|
maxEntityChangeSyncIdAtLoad: <%= maxEntityChangeSyncIdAtLoad %>,
|
2019-03-24 22:41:53 +01:00
|
|
|
instanceName: '<%= instanceName %>',
|
2019-12-29 23:46:40 +01:00
|
|
|
csrfToken: '<%= csrfToken %>',
|
2020-04-25 23:52:13 +02:00
|
|
|
isDev: <%= isDev %>,
|
2022-05-30 22:32:15 +02:00
|
|
|
appCssNoteIds: <%- JSON.stringify(appCssNoteIds) %>,
|
2022-12-25 11:58:24 +01:00
|
|
|
isMainWindow: true,
|
2022-10-26 23:50:54 +02:00
|
|
|
isProtectedSessionAvailable: <%= isProtectedSessionAvailable %>,
|
2022-12-13 16:57:46 +01:00
|
|
|
assetPath: "<%= assetPath %>",
|
2022-12-25 11:58:24 +01:00
|
|
|
appPath: "<%= appPath %>",
|
2022-12-24 13:57:42 +01:00
|
|
|
TRILIUM_SAFE_MODE: <%= !!process.env.TRILIUM_SAFE_MODE %>
|
2018-12-23 22:28:57 +01:00
|
|
|
};
|
|
|
|
</script>
|
|
|
|
|
2023-11-22 20:11:41 +01:00
|
|
|
<script src="<%= assetPath %>/node_modules/jquery/dist/jquery.min.js"></script>
|
2025-01-04 23:43:15 +02:00
|
|
|
|
|
|
|
<script src="<%= assetPath %>/node_modules/autocomplete.js/dist/autocomplete.jquery.min.js"></script>
|
2018-12-23 22:28:57 +01:00
|
|
|
|
2023-11-22 19:58:54 +01:00
|
|
|
<script src="<%= assetPath %>/node_modules/dayjs/dayjs.min.js"></script>
|
2019-03-13 22:43:59 +01:00
|
|
|
|
2022-10-26 23:50:54 +02:00
|
|
|
<link href="<%= assetPath %>/stylesheets/tree.css" rel="stylesheet">
|
2024-08-14 19:15:07 +03:00
|
|
|
<script src="<%= assetPath %>/node_modules/jquery.fancytree/dist/jquery.fancytree-all-deps.min.js"></script>
|
2018-12-23 22:28:57 +01:00
|
|
|
|
2024-08-11 01:59:50 +02:00
|
|
|
<link href="<%= assetPath %>/node_modules/bootstrap/dist/css/bootstrap.min.css" rel="stylesheet">
|
|
|
|
<script src="<%= assetPath %>/node_modules/bootstrap/dist/js/bootstrap.bundle.min.js"></script>
|
2018-12-24 12:49:27 +01:00
|
|
|
|
2022-12-25 11:58:24 +01:00
|
|
|
<script src="<%= appPath %>/mobile.js" crossorigin type="module"></script>
|
2018-12-23 22:28:57 +01:00
|
|
|
|
2021-09-27 21:01:56 +02:00
|
|
|
<link href="api/fonts" rel="stylesheet">
|
2022-10-26 23:50:54 +02:00
|
|
|
<link href="<%= assetPath %>/stylesheets/ckeditor-theme.css" rel="stylesheet">
|
|
|
|
<link href="<%= assetPath %>/stylesheets/theme-light.css" rel="stylesheet">
|
2021-09-26 15:24:37 +02:00
|
|
|
<% if (themeCssUrl) { %>
|
|
|
|
<link href="<%= themeCssUrl %>" rel="stylesheet">
|
|
|
|
<% } %>
|
2022-10-26 23:50:54 +02:00
|
|
|
<link href="<%= assetPath %>/stylesheets/style.css" rel="stylesheet">
|
2018-12-23 22:28:57 +01:00
|
|
|
|
2023-11-22 20:06:44 +01:00
|
|
|
<link rel="stylesheet" type="text/css" href="<%= assetPath %>/node_modules/boxicons/css/boxicons.min.css">
|
2018-12-28 20:36:18 +01:00
|
|
|
|
2019-03-13 22:43:59 +01:00
|
|
|
</body>
|
2020-07-01 23:35:00 +02:00
|
|
|
</html>
|